You’ll be in good company if you decide to attend Case Western Reserve University. It ranked #1 on our 2022 Best Value Patent Law Schools for a Master’s in the Great Lakes Region list. Case Western Reserve University is a fairly large private not-for-profit school situated in Cleveland, Ohio. It awarded 4 masters’s patent law degrees in 2019-2020.

Case Western also made our “Best Patent Law Master’s Degree Schools in the Great Lakes Region” list, coming in at #1. Average graduate tuition and fees at Case Western Reserve University are $47,958, but you may pay more or less depending on your major.
